mirror of
https://github.com/wfjm/w11.git
synced 2026-01-24 03:46:32 +00:00
30 lines
1011 B
Plaintext
30 lines
1011 B
Plaintext
; $Id: vec_cpucatch_reset.mac 830 2016-12-26 20:25:49Z mueller $
|
|
; Copyright 2015- by Walter F.J. Mueller <W.F.J.Mueller@gsi.de>
|
|
; License disclaimer see License.txt in $RETROBASE directory
|
|
;
|
|
; re-write vector catcher for basic cpu interrupts
|
|
;
|
|
mov #v..iit+2,v..iit ; vec 4
|
|
clr v..iit+2
|
|
mov #v..rit+2,v..rit ; vec 10
|
|
clr v..rit+2
|
|
;
|
|
mov #v..bpt+2,v..bpt ; vec 14 (T bit; BPT)
|
|
clr v..bpt+2
|
|
mov #v..iot+2,v..iot ; vec 20 (IOT)
|
|
clr v..iot+2
|
|
mov #v..pwr+2,v..pwr ; vec 24 (Power fail, not used)
|
|
clr v..pwr+2
|
|
mov #v..emt+2,v..emt ; vec 30 (EMT)
|
|
clr v..emt+2
|
|
mov #v..trp+2,v..trp ; vec 34 (TRAP)
|
|
clr v..trp+2
|
|
;
|
|
mov #v..pir+2,v..pir ; vec 240 (PIRQ)
|
|
clr v..pir+2
|
|
mov #v..fpp+2,v..fpp ; vec 244 (FPP)
|
|
clr v..fpp+2
|
|
mov #v..mmu+2,v..mmu ; vec 250 (MMU)
|
|
clr v..mmu+2
|
|
;
|